On January 17 1970 — Major league teams select a record 357 players in the January phase of the annual free-agent draft, including top pick Chris Chambliss, by Cleveland, and Chris Speier.
The Yankees draft Fred Lynn in the third round of the January phase of the free-agent draft, but the El Monte High School senior chooses to attend USC on a scholarship to play football… The 17 year-old Californian, who will join the Trojan’s baseball squad in his freshman year. He will be drafted by the Boston Red Sox in the 2nd round of the 1973 MLB June Amateur Draftbecomes the first player in MLB history to win the MVP and Rookie of the Year awards in the same season while playing for the 1975 Red Sox.
